Title:
METHOD FOR REFINING TITANIUM-CONTAINING MATERIAL
Document Type and Number:
Japanese Patent JPH0688149
Kind Code:
A
Abstract:
PURPOSE: To remove the radioactive element component incorporated into a titanium-contg. material which is a raw material for production of titanium tetrachloride by a simple means.
CONSTITUTION: The titanium-contg. material is subjected to a heating treatment in an aq. mineral acid soln. in such a manner that the total removal rate of an uranium component and throium component is ≥60% and that the fine grain components of 200 meshes in the treated product attain ≤1%. The radioactive element components are effectively removed while the generation of the fine-grained components and the degradation in the yield of TiO2 are suppressed.
